Full description The Skiltrek Team supports the United States Navy in their goal of providing reliable and secure information services to their shore-based networks. Our customer Client has an opening for a Junior Network technician, supporting the NGEN-SMIT Team, in providing IT Services. Job Responsibilities: - Knowledgeable engineer in the field of Ethernet and IP data engineering with 4 plus years' experience as a Network Technician. - Position requires a high school diploma and a Security+ CE - Fundamental understanding of the OSI Model is required. - Experience must include operational support, and configuration of network devices such as servers, routers, switches, associated software tools, and cabling experience. - Knowledge of network protocols - You will be part of a Team of Network Technicians and Engineers. Overview of Duties: - Provide network technical advice and assistance during the planning phase of a deployment or exercise and coordinate swift solutions to networking problems during the execution phase. Provide direct computer and network support to include router, firewall, Intrusion Detection Systems/Intrusion Prevention Systems (IDS/IPS), Domain Name System (DNS), Active Directory (AD) and Exchange, configuration, installation, maintenance and troubleshooting. - Support operational requirements for the operational environment; identify required Hardware (HW) and Software (SW); - Coordinate return of any unused and reusable equipment to stock; coordinate the transportation of all HW and SW required to support contingency operations and obtain all import permits. - Expected to understand, implement, and follow processes in accordance with current policies and procedures. Performed escalation and additional tasks as directed. - Investigated, resolved, documented, and reported the cause and corrective actions in the Incident Management System for all incidents assigned by the Service Desk.
